The XPG Spectrix S40G RGB is a solid-state drive in the M.2 2280 form factor, launched on May 24th, 2019. It is available in capacities ranging from 256 GB to 4 TB. This page reports specifications for the 4 TB variant. With the rest of the system, the XPG Spectrix S40G RGB interfaces using a PCI-Express 3.0 x4 connection. The SSD controller is the RTS5762 from Realtek, a DRAM cache chip is available. XPG has installed 96-layer QLC NAND flash on the Spectrix S40G RGB, the flash chips are made by Micron. Please note that this SSD is sold in multiple variants with different NAND flash or controller, which could affect performance, the "Notes" section at the end of this page has more info. To improve write speeds, a pseudo-SLC cache is used, so bursts of incoming writes are handled more quickly. The Spectrix S40G RGB is rated for sequential read speeds of up to 3,500 MB/s and 3,000 MB/s write; random IO reaches 290K IOPS for read and 240K for writes.
At its launch, the SSD was priced at 500 USD. The warranty length is set to five years, which is an excellent warranty period. XPG guarantees an endurance rating of 2560 TBW, a typical value for consumer SSDs.

Notes

Drive:

The 4TB variant comes with Micron QLC NAND 96-Layers
Suffers from Thermal Throtling under heavy load because of the RGB lighting.

Controller:

This Realtek controller is a Hybrid controller, it supports DRAM Cache for storing Meta-Data, but also supports H.M.B. (Host Memory Buffer)
